Raj Thackeray's meeting with Devendra Fadnavis sparks political buzz. This follows a defeat for Shiv Sena (UBT) and MNS in the BEST credit society elections. The loss is seen as a setback before the upcoming BMC polls. Fadnavis commented on the rejection of the 'Thackeray brand'. Raj Thackeray had recently shared a stage with Uddhav, criticizing the BJP's language policy.

A tragic accident in West Bengal's Burdwan district claimed the lives of at least 10 people and left 35 injured. A passenger bus collided with a stationary truck on National Highway 19 near Nala Ferry Ghat around 7 am on Friday. Rescue teams promptly responded, transporting the injured to nearby hospitals.

Karsan Ghavri revealed Sunil Gavaskar's unwavering focus, recalling an instance when Gavaskar prioritized his batting concentration over meeting then Prime Minister Morarji Desai. Ghavri also highlighted Gavaskar's infamous slow innings in the 1975 World Cup, where he defied team expectations and played at his own pace, frustrating teammates with his unconventional approach.

Bitcoin soared to a record high of $124,500 on Thursday, driven by positive US market sentiment and regulatory changes. Analysts attribute the surge to President Trump's policies easing restrictions on crypto firms, encouraging institutional investment. Major players like Trump's media group and Tesla have significantly contributed to the rally.
